As the second round of the NFL playoffs appear on the horizon it becomes time to look into our crystal ball and make our predictions for the four upcoming contests which should be the most exciting in years.
We will first look at what has to be the feature game on the weekend and that is the number one ranked AFC team The San Diego Chargers {14-2} hosting the {13-4} New England Patriots.The game is in San Diego and for that reason alone the Chargers should be favoured as history shows Eastern teams have had virtually no success at Playoff time on the West Coast..However in this one you can throw out the form charts
The reason being Bill Belichick and Tom Brady ,the coach and Quarterback of the Pats. There can be no doubt in anybody's mind that Tom Brady is a winner as since taking over from Drew Bledsoe as The Patriots number one signal caller in 2001 his playoff record is 11 and 1 with three Super Bowl rings and a Super Bowl MVP award to show for his efforts. Brady has been razor sharp lately with no interceptions in five of his last six games.
Belichick as a Head Coach in playoff action is considered to be one of the best because of his ability to motivate his team to perform at optimum levels and his ability to make adjustments on the fly.
On the other hand Marty Schottenheimer, San Diego's head honcho, has a 5-12 record in the playoffs and his inability to get his division winning Cleveland Browns and Kansas City Cheifs into the SuperBowl is history.Marty,s teams in the past have had trouble winning the big games.This game will be no different as the New Englanders will break the hearts of the San Diego faithful.
We are predicting that the Patriots will do it again and advance to the AFC Final against Baltimore who will defeat the Indianapolis Colts because of the play of their top ranked defence .The Colt defence was impressive in defeating Kansas City last weekend but since Head Coach Brian Billick took over the play calling the Raven offence has improved dramatically.and will be to much for the Colts to handle and the playoff jinx that haunts the Peyton Manning lead crew will once again rear its ugly head.
Over in the NFC you expect another upset with Jeff Garcia, the former Calgary Stampeder, leading the Eagles {10-6} to a close decision over the New Orleans Saints[10-6] before a wild and woolly crowd at the Superdome.The Eagles are loaded with playoff experience and are six and one with Garcia at the controls and have been in the NFC playoffs for the last five consecutive years. The Saints on the other hand have only seen post season action .on a couple of occassions.The Eagles are hitting on all cylinders and win the battle in the trenches on both sides of the ball. And running back Brian Westbrook is playing the best football of his career.
The other game features the number one ranked NFL team The Monsters of the Midway the Chicago Bears at {13-3} against the Seattle Seahawks{9-7} who struggled to win their division and were lucky to beat Dallas last weekend.The Seahawks are injury riddled.and for that reason the well rested Bears should have little trouble in coming out on the long end of the score and acquire the right to host the NFC Championship game on the 14th of this month.
So there you have it. The winners will be The Patriots and,The Ravens in the AFC and The Eagles and Bears in the NFC. You can take it to the bank.
